The Prophecy

I could not believe what I had just heard from the person that I assumed to be dead years ago. She just handed us the key to defeating Cerberus once and for all and returning this country to what is used to be known for. But we still have a long way to go and now have to find this Creator.

I think most of us were still in shock as the room remained silent for several long minutes with no one willing to be the first to talk. I was still even in shock as all these thoughts were dashing through my head on where to even start. Keegan could be anywhere in the world. Where do we even begin?

I was the first to break the silence in the room. Jill knew something about Keegan that she needed to tell us.

“I take it that you know this person my mother is talking about.”

“Not just me,” she answered to my surprise. “Many of us in this room know him. I had no idea.”

I turned my head and looked over towards Joe as he starred off in the distance and refused to make eye contact with anyone.

“Joe?” I asked as I walked over towards him.

Joe was silent for a few seconds until he gained enough momentum to answer my question.

“The best friend anyone could have asked for,” he answered as he fought from the tears sliding down his face. “But to know now that he is responsible for everything that has happened. I guess I didn’t really know him.”

“That is not true, Joe,” Jill quickly interrupted. “I was with him on the day of the Cerberus Hack. He fought off the robots and is the only reason I’m still alive. He was the person we knew and remember. We just don’t have the full story.”

“He didn’t just save Jill,” Kevin joined in. “But saved me too. He’s the only reason we were able to get out of the White House on that day. I was sure he was dead though.”

I looked around at all those who knew him and could see in their eyes that this person had impacted each and every one of them in some way that everyone aims at doing at some point in their life on another. He was not just a friend but was family too. Just like we had all grown on each other and formed a family bond with one another. Even Susan was being silent and that meant something too.

I was the one to take charge of the group as they all were clearly still in shock and ignored the fact that we were still in a Cerberus base with reinforcements not far behind.

“Then we’ll find him,” I said to all of them as they looked up at me. “Keegan holds the key to the future of the world. Only he can stop Cerberus but he’ll need our help to do it. My mother trusted and believed in him and that’s good enough for me.
